The PIC16F1933T-I/SS is a microcontroller belonging to the PIC16 family of microcontrollers produced by Microchip Technology. The PIC16F1933T-I/SS operates based on the Harvard architecture, featuring separate program and data memories. It executes instructions fetched from program memory and interacts with external components through its I/O pins and integrated peripherals.
The PIC16F1933T-I/SS is suitable for various embedded control applications, including but not limited to: - Home automation systems - Industrial control systems - Consumer electronics - Automotive electronics
Some alternative models to the PIC16F1933T-I/SS include: - PIC16F1934 - PIC16F1936 - PIC16F1937
These alternatives offer varying memory sizes, peripheral configurations, and package options to cater to different project requirements.

What is the maximum operating frequency of PIC16F1933T-I/SS?
- The maximum operating frequency of PIC16F1933T-I/SS is 32 MHz.
Can PIC16F1933T-I/SS be used for motor control applications?
- Yes, PIC16F1933T-I/SS can be used for motor control applications with its integrated peripherals and PWM capabilities.
Does PIC16F1933T-I/SS support communication protocols like I2C and SPI?
- Yes, PIC16F1933T-I/SS supports both I2C and SPI communication protocols.

What development tools are available for programming PIC16F1933T-I/SS?
- Development tools such as MPLAB X IDE and MPLAB Code Configurator support programming and configuration of PIC16F1933T-I/SS.
